    Very good selections! I enjoy both of those and use them at their highest setting. Some folks like to work their way up from low numbers.

    Are you familiar with the peculiarities of the two tools? On the Gillette - the quarter turn lock down. After the doors are closed, just a little more and it's got some resistance. With the Futur clone - orientation of the cap to the base plate. There's two ways to click it on. The right way aligns and secures better than the other way.

    After a bit of research, I ordered the Oren razor. It arrived yesterday, and I’ll be having my first shave with it this morning. I’ve been interested in the AC razors, and apparently caught RAD here! Woe is me!!! I thought the Karve would be it, but apparently not! In any case her is a quick shot of it. The razor comes with three heads, a one dot, two dot and three dot, in order of increased aggressiveness. I switched to the one dot given my respect for feather blades, and my long history of shaving with a mild razor (Krona). Images will follow.

    Well folks, the shave did not go the way I hoped. It will definitely take time for me to get used to the Oren razor. Shaving with my Krona, and even my Karve is generally on autopilot. I'm very comfortable with the dimensions of the razor head, and can pretty much not think through the shave, if you know what I mean. The sheer size of the AC blade requires an equivalent adjustment in the size of the razor head, and it's big!! Huge, honkin' big! The AC crowd praises the area covered in each shaving stroke. I found the I wasn't able to shave around my beard as easily, given the size of the razor head size. It felt very awkward. I guess in time that should pass, but this morning it was an issue. In addition, I discovered that the one dot head did not give me the kind of close shave I was looking for. So after cleaning up the razor, I removed the one dot head and replaced it the the two dot that it arrived with. Should have just left it alone. Hopefully, the new head will not require the amount of buffing that this head did. On the positive side, those AC Feather Pro blades are sharp and the razor head is designed to avoid end knicking. So there were no weepers and no razor burn, despite a great deal of buffing. I generally shave every other day, but given the closeness of this shave, may need to shave again tomorrow. I'll keep you posted.
